Craine estate sous-fonds

This sous-fonds consists of the business papers of three members of the Craine family who lived in the town of Smiths Falls. The papers cover the period from 1852-1938 when they end with the death of Dr. Agnes Craine. The bulk of the papers consists of consist of mortgages, insurance policies, stock holdings, day books and wills of three family members - John Joseph Craine, John Craine and Dr. Agnes D. Craine. There is also some correspondence from family relations, travel diaries of Agnes Douglas Craine, news clippings, wills and estate holdings of Craine relations from the Isle of Man, and a brush drawing of Douglas Craine.

Dennis Lake estate sous-fonds

The land papers in this sous-fonds trace the changes in ownership of various lots, often from the original Crown grants. The business papers reflect interest rates, rents, assessments and taxes, school tuition, wages paid for work on the farm and the clearing of land. The prices of various household commodities, receipts for carding and fulling, invoices for spinning and weaving, and for tailoring, give interesting information about household life during the main span of years covered, 1832 to 1874.
